在visual studio c ++项目中使用dcmtk库

时间:2013-11-23 10:50:40

标签: dicom

尽管尝试了不同的配置,我还是无法在vs中使用dcmtk。

  • 我使用cmake创建了vs sln文件。然后我成功编译了ALL_BUILD和INSTALL项目。我在Documents下创建了testapp文件夹,并在其中保存了CMakeLists.txt文件和testapp.cxx文件。然后运行cmake。但是在编译创建的testapp.sln时出现错误:.h文件无法找到错误。可能它与此行有关:SET(DCMTK_DIR C:\ dcmtk-bin \ x64 \ Debug \ INSTALL)。该文件夹中只有一些配置文件。如何设置此路径?

(我跟着How to use Dcmtk in Qt?http://forum.dcmtk.org/viewtopic.php?f=4&t=2691&sid=4934767cd29f8a950a51ea7466235b0e进行了此操作。)

  • 我放弃了使用CMake,并尝试直接从原始库文件夹(而不是由cmake创建的文件夹)设置vs c ++项目包含和库设置。我将include设置为所有文件夹的include文件夹。并且库文件作为所有文件夹的“libsrc文件夹”,即直接cpp文件进行了演示。并没有设置其他输入。 编译后,出现了很多错误,特别是与intellisense,typedef用法等有关。

  • 最后,我根据cmake创建的dcmtk文件夹进行了包含和库设置。但是在包含文件中没有.h文件。

如何成功编写简单的dcmtk项目?准确的位置,设置必须是什么?由于缺乏经验,我需要比我读过的答案更清晰的答案。

谢谢。

0 个答案:

没有答案